New Delhi, May 7 -- A number of staffers onboard a Disney cruise ship docked in San Diego in California of the United States were arrested for their direct or indirect involvement in child pornography racket, law enforcement officials were quoted as saying by New York Post.

According to the report, US Customs and Border Protection boarded five cruise ships which also included the Disney cruise ship between April 23 and April 25. They were investigating the child sexual exploitation material (CSEM) enforcement operations, a CBP spokesperson told The California Post.
